How to become a live in rail switchman?

To become a live-in rail switchman,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, relevant experience in railway operations, and knowledge of safety protocols. Training is often provided on the job, and certifications such as OSHA safety training or railroad-specific credentials may be required. Physical fitness and the ability to work irregular hours are also important for this role.

What is the difference between Live In Rail Switchman vs Rail Yard Clerk?

AspectLive In Rail SwitchmanRail Yard Clerk
CredentialsHigh school diploma, safety certificationsHigh school diploma, administrative skills
Work EnvironmentRailroad tracks, switching yards, outdoorOffice, rail yard administrative areas
Employer & IndustryRailroads, freight companiesRailroads, logistics companies

The Live In Rail Switchman primarily works outdoors on the tracks, performing switching and safety duties, often living on-site. In contrast, the Rail Yard Clerk handles administrative tasks within the yard, managing schedules and documentation. Both roles are essential in rail operations but differ significantly in work environment and responsibilities.

What You Will Be Doing

As an ITS Project Manager, this role will serve as the technical and project lead for mid‑ to large‑scale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) projects. This hybrid position may be based in any one of our office locations.

Responsibilities include leading the planning, design, and implementation of advanced ITS infrastructure such as communications networks, system integration, transit signal priority, and connected corridor technologies. This position plays a strategic role in supporting regional growth, strengthening client relationships, and contributing to pursuit and capture efforts within our municipal and transit markets.

  • Serving as Lead Engineer and Project Manager on mid‑ to large‑scale ITS projects
  • Providing specialized technical expertise in ITS planning, design, and system integration
  • Leading development of technical studies, detailed design packages, and implementation strategies
  • Presenting complex technical solutions and recommendations to state, municipal, and transit clients
  • Performing quality control reviews and approving technical work prepared by project teams
  • Developing project scopes, schedules, engineering budgets, and resource plans
  • Coordinating across multidisciplinary teams including traffic, roadway, rail, and communications
  • Preparing and contributing to technical proposals, fee estimates, and pursuit strategies
  • Supporting business development efforts and maintaining strong client relationships with state, municipal, and transit agencies
  • Ensuring compliance with applicable state, local, and federal transportation standards
